Job description
As a Senior Design Quality Engineer, you will serve as a technical authority on complex systems, designs, and quality engineering decision-making. Reporting directly to the Senior Manager, Quality (based at our Shanghai office), you will act as the primary hands-on bridge between Product Development (NPD) and mass production. Your mission is to embed a âDesign for Qualityâ mentality early in the product lifecycle, ensuring it isnât just a phrase, but a verified, repeatable reality before high-volume manufacturing begins. You will act as the upstream gatekeeper, ensuring designs are mature and fully validated before handoff to our China-based quality team who manage ongoing mass production.
You will work as part of the product development teams on complex tasks and longer-term projects, taking ownership of timelines and driving successful outcomes without the need for continual guidance. This is an on-site role, working a minimum of 4 days per week from our office in Broxburn, Scotland. The role also requires the ability to travel to China and other SE Asia countries approximately 4-6 times a year.
What youâll do:
- Early-Stage Design Partnership: Actively partner with Product Design Engineers from the initial project kick-off to embed âDesign for Qualityâ principles early in the R&D lifecycle. You will ensure that quality, reliability, and manufacturing constraints are inherently built into the product design long before the design freeze for mass production.
- Risk Management & Mitigation (DFMEA): Serve as the technical authority on risk-assessment methodologies. You will lead and facilitate Design Failure Mode and Effects Analyses (DFMEAs) alongside the design team, proactively identifying potential failure modes, establishing critical-to-quality (CTQ) characteristics, and implementing mitigation strategies.
- Strategy & Forward Planning: Think 6-12 months ahead to align design-quality milestones with project goals. Proactively shape the productâs design by contributing technical insights, test observations, and engineering feedback gained from early prototype evaluations.
- NPD Project Leadership: Lead the quality engineering strands of complex, cross-functional New Product Development (NPD) projects. Take full ownership of qualification metrics to drive successful product launches.
- Cross-Functional Integration & Peer Alignment: Maintain close, collaborative relationships with compliance, engineering, sourcing, CPI and supply chain peers. Articulate how design tolerances overlap with supplier capabilities, ensuring a smooth handoff from prototype verification to factory floor execution.
- Process Governance & Validation Standards: Own and define the product quality criteria in our Quality Control (QC) documentation. Set rigorous standards for design verification testing (DVT) and production validation testing (PVT). Consistently deliver high-quality results, ensuring new appliance designs comply with Ooniâs internal standards, global regulatory benchmarks, and industry compliance.
- Data-Driven Engineering Decisions: Fairly assess complex testing inputs, tolerance stack-ups, and statistical data to make rational, well-informed design-quality decisions. Rationalize engineering trade-offs using ROI calculations. For highly complex issues where prototype data may be incomplete or unreliable, proactively collaborate with senior team members for support.
- Advanced Problem Solving: Adapt quickly to unexpected prototype failures or unfamiliar technical challenges. Champion root-cause analysis frameworks (such as 8D or Six Sigma) to solve complex issues, pushing beyond standard best practices to help design novel, robust solutions and product features.
- Stakeholder Communication: Tailor complex technical data and validation results into clear, concise updates for cross-functional stakeholders. Appropriately summarize lengthy testing reports and confidently present design-readiness findings to the wider department or business.
Requirements
Do you have experience in Root cause analysis?, * Technical Expertise: Significant experience in quality engineering, design verification, or regulatory compliance specifically for consumer appliances, gas, or electrical products.
- Project Ownership: Proven experience working independently to drive complex technical projects to successful outcomes within a fast-paced consumer goods environment.
- Problem Solving Mastery: Mastery of Quality and Design Tools (e.g., DFMEA/PFMEA, 8D, Six Sigma, Lean, or Design of Experiments) with a strong âsystem-thinkingâ approach.
- Communication & Inclusivity: Excellent interpersonal skills with the ability to account for different personalities and levels of experience, communicating in a way that is inclusive, persuasive, and effective.
- Operational Agility: Demonstrated ability to manage day-to-day prototyping and manufacturing quality issues while simultaneously planning 6-12 months down the line., When you join one of our global teams, youâre joining a dedicated group of do-ers who value Kindness, Passion, Innovation, Ambition and Rigor above all else.
